- Bjerring GambleNov 16, 2024 · a year agoCandlestick charts are a vital tool in cryptocurrency trading as they provide valuable insights into price movements and market trends. By analyzing the patterns formed by the candlesticks, traders can make informed decisions about when to buy or sell cryptocurrencies. These charts display the opening, closing, high, and low prices within a specific time period, allowing traders to identify patterns such as bullish or bearish trends, reversal patterns, and support and resistance levels. Overall, candlestick charts help traders understand market sentiment and improve their chances of making profitable trades.
